BIOGENETICS

 
Published: Wednesday 31 May 1995

A new patent dispute - the New York-based Enzo Biochern Inc vs Calgene Inc - is expected to tie the US judiciary into knots. Calgene's technique for genetically altering its Flavr Savr tomatoes (Down To Earth, Vol 3, No 4) has been called into question in a federal court case in Wilmington, Delaware, by Enzo, which claims that it was based on fraudulent research. Calgene was tightlipped on the issue.
